This is a mint condition unissued example of a very scarce Airborne Paratrooper Flag Armband. This type of armband was typically used by U. S. Paratroopers for example in North Africa (1942), during the D Day invasion in Normandy (June 1944) and during Operation Market Garden (September 1944).
